Red folders are those that are new posts and/or ones that you have not read yet.  

Yellow folders indicate that you've popped in and out of the site and have previously seen the folder.  Another way to know if you've read the poem is that the color of the caption should change from a dark blue to a light blue [unless you clear your history.]

Gray folders indicate that the poet has come back to review the responses, and has left a message of "thanks" or otherwise comment on the remarks.

There is a fairly extensive article in the Member's Area/Troubleshooting about cookies (which is what makes those color changes possible), and anyone who finds the color changes don't work for them should probably read it.

But, in a nutshell, the number one reason for "all yellow folders" is the result of starting your session in the wrong place.

If you have bookmarked a specific forum, instead of coming in our "front" door, your cookies are NOT getting stamped with a date and time and the system has no idea what you have and have not seen.

Also, because cookies only work within a single domain, your folders will not work properly if you start your session in anything that has a www in front of it. The domain www.piptalk.com  is NOT the same as piptalk.com and should NOT be used by anyone.

There are ONLY two safe pages to bookmark for the start of your session:

/

/main/Ultimate.cgi
